    Kagain if vanilla, Shar-teel if Tutu.

    Only reason I say this is because it occurred to recently that Kagain's 20 CON is a *huge*advantage in the original game, where you had limited pots, only 1 healing spell until cleric level 7, and no "rest until healed."

    This actually makes vanilla more interesting, because if multiple party members get hurt, you're S-O-L until you can get to a temple.

    In Tutu (and presumably, BG:EE), Kagain's regenerative abilities aren't unique. "Rest until healed" essentially gives that power to your entire party.

    Well the thing is a shapeshifter is a druid that needs to melee, and it can't wear any armor. The class itself is gimped while in human form. Its kind of evil even though its a TN class because you get to be a werewolf. Unfortunately the early game is easy as pie in werewolf form, not what I expected so its not really the gimpy class I once thought it was! But you can't cast any spells while being a werewolf.

    My current BGT-WEIDU evil party (a training run for BGEE) is almost the same, but CHARNAME is a lawful evil elf Fighter/Mage and I have Monteron as a stealthy backstabber/off-tank, as required. I did consider swapping Imoen for Safana (who is chaotic neutral), but think Imoen is a slightly better thief, has more useful weapon proficiences in BGT, is part of the main plot, and doesn't leave the party even when your reputation is rock-bottom, despite her good alignment (I think Jaheria is similar, in this respect).

    Kagain is an awesome tank, once you give him something to boost his Dex, and Viconia and Edwin are the best cleric and mage, respectively, in the game. BTW in case you're not aware, on top of her good stats (and cool picture and voice) Viconia has high magic resistance as a special ability.

    Its only very recently that I've played an evil party in BG1, and I'm having much more fun than with the good "canon" party... :-) Apparently its harder in BG2, though...

    BTW don't forget the evil Bhaal powers you get after the dream sequences if your reputation is <10, again more fun than the "good" ones...
